Q: Is 4,845,418 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,845,418 is a composite number.

Why is 4,845,418 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,845,418 can be evenly divided by 1 2 19 38 47 94 893 1,786 2,713 5,426 51,547 103,094 127,511 255,022 2,422,709 and 4,845,418, with no remainder.

Since 4,845,418 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,845,418, it is a composite number.
